Avena: A Magical Script Font

Avena is a magical script font that brings elegance and charm to digital design. As a web designer, I appreciate fonts that not only look good but also enhance the user experience. Avena fits perfectly into this category, offering a unique blend of style and functionality.

Designed with a touch of sophistication, Avena has a fluid, flowing structure that mimics handwritten script. Its curves and strokes add a personal, artistic feel to any layout. Whether you're working on a website, landing page, or digital product, Avena can elevate your design with its refined aesthetic.

Using Avena in Web Design

Avena excels in visual hierarchy, making it ideal for headers, hero sections, and call-to-action areas. Its bold yet graceful appearance draws attention without overwhelming the reader. When used as a headline, Avena adds a sense of luxury and creativity to your design.

For example, in a creative portfolio site, Avena can be used to highlight project titles or artist names. In an online store, it works well for banners and promotional graphics, adding a touch of elegance to product displays. On a coaching website, Avena can be used in section headings to create a warm, inviting tone.

In digital ads, Avena stands out as a display font, capturing the viewer's eye while maintaining readability. It’s also effective for short phrases, such as taglines or logo text, where a strong visual impact is needed.

Readability and Visual Hierarchy

While Avena is a decorative script font, it maintains a level of legibility that makes it suitable for certain digital applications. However, it's best used in small doses, such as headlines or decorative accents, rather than long blocks of text.

On mobile screens, Avena performs well when used at larger sizes. For smaller buttons or text elements, consider using a simpler font for better clarity. When paired with dark or light backgrounds, Avena retains its visual appeal, but ensure there's sufficient contrast for optimal readability.

When used on image overlays, Avena adds a refined touch, especially when combined with minimalist designs. Its flowing lines complement modern typography, making it a versatile choice for various digital contexts.

Font Pairing and Brand Identity

Pairing Avena with other fonts can enhance its impact. For instance, pairing it with a clean sans serif font like Roboto or Open Sans creates a balanced contrast between the decorative script and the simple body text. This combination works well for landing pages, blog headers, and content sections.

If you're aiming for an editorial design, pairing Avena with a serif font like Georgia or Playfair Display can create a more traditional, sophisticated look. This approach is great for blogs, magazine-style websites, or brand kits that require a timeless feel.

For a more contemporary identity, consider using Avena alongside a geometric sans serif like Futura or Montserrat. This pairing offers a modern, dynamic aesthetic that suits tech startups, SaaS platforms, or creative agencies.

Commercial Licensing and File Formats

Before using Avena in commercial projects, ensure you have the proper licensing. Most fonts come with specific terms for website use, client projects, and online stores. Check the font’s license agreement to confirm what’s allowed.

Avena typically includes multiple file formats, such as OTF and TTF, making it compatible with most design software. If you're using it for web design, verify that it’s available as a webfont, such as WOFF or WOFF2, for seamless integration into your site.

Some fonts include alternate characters or ligatures, which can add variety to your design. Explore these options to customize Avena for different layouts and brand needs.

Avena supports multilingual characters, making it suitable for international audiences. This feature is especially useful if your brand targets a global market or requires translations in multiple languages.
